    settings is okay, set USB device to camera with LOOP capture devices on first/second picture.


    Hyperion.NG redetects them the whole time on USB grabber setting , when switched to CAMERA that stops.

    Hyperion.NG sees the device as a camera because of the LOOP capturing, probably there's a chip inside which tells the Hyperion.NG software "i am a camera"
